The outing comes just weeks after the teen scored her first magazine cover with Nylon, where she was introduced as the publication’s August “It” girl.
In the spread, Sunday admitted she wasn’t even allowed to step into modeling until she turned 16, thanks to rules set by her famous parents. “School always has to come first,” she told the magazine. While she admitted she "hated" it at first, she said she's really glad now because having these "rules in place" keeps her "in a good mindset."
Kidman opened up about her rules in 2024 in an interview with Victoria Beckham. At the time, Rose had just attended a Balenciaga show. “She’s about to turn 16. That’s what I told her. When she was 16, she was allowed to come to a show," she told Beckam. "She’s wanted to go for a long time. That was her foray into it, and that was it. I’m like, no, no more. It’s a push-pull. I don’t want to hold her back because I don’t want to be coddling her."
Now that she has her parents' approval to start working, they've attended events together, and there's no doubt that Rose has a bright career ahead of her in modeling. She has already walked for Miu Miu, starred in its Spring 2025 campaign, and is showing face at the hottest events.
She told Nylon her love of fashion started when she watched her mom when she was a little girl. "Growing up, I went to my mom’s photo shoots a lot and got to observe, which definitely led to my interest in exploring the modeling world," she explained.
It's clear she appreciates designers, and she said she loves how every brand is different. "Just watching the shows, you can see how each designer expresses themself in a different way through the collection."
